shift1313 Posted March 5, 2013 Report Share Posted March 5, 2013 Does anyone know the torque specs for out manual transmission? Transmission is almost done. Thank you. Starter motor - 16-23ftlbsengine to tranny 31-40mainshaft locking nut - 196-216countershaft locking nut - 116-137idler shaft locking nut - 15-43drain plug - 44oil filler plug - 22-25Back up light switch - 22under cover - 6-7seal plug - 22-30speedo clamp - 7.5-9 is that what you need?
